Measuring at 3. Featuring both cotton and spandex, these wrist sweatbands are breathable, lightweight, absorbent and will remain in place on your wrist even during vigorous exercise. This is why we have commonly seen and even used things such as bandanas as makeshift sweatbands of sorts.
Cotton items such as bandanas work as they are easily folded over and tied securely around the head. However, many cotton materials do not stay in place as they have little give and flexibility. Therefore, cotton sweatbands are not entirely ideal—especially if you are looking for a long-term accessory. When many think of different sweatband materials, terry cloth is the first one the comes to mind.
Simply put, the majority of sweatbands are crafted from this multi-function, multi-purpose fabric. The main reasons behind its frequent utilization include the fact that terry cloth is not only absorbent but truly comfortable against the wearers' skin.
Most importantly, terry cloth has that perfect amount of elasticity to help keep it in place comfortably while soaking up each drop of sweat. If you are looking to be industrious and craft your own sweatbands from home, as far as different sweatband materials are concerned, microfiber is the absolute best choice for homemade sweatbands.
Not only does microfiber effectively absorb sweat, but it is also sweat-wicking in addition. For the best results, one can place material around a wide elastic headband, making for a cozy and thrifty way to combat sweat and uncontrollable hair. As it turns out, there are several different ways in which one can wear a sweatband with short hair. In fact, a stylish sweatband can even add to the appearance of short hair, allowing you to stand out without spending an hour styling your hair. One thing to keep in mind is that many of us utilize more product in our hair to control it when it is shorter.
This product can build up on your sweatband, so be sure to keep it clean. Also, when an active person has short hair they should aim for a thinner sweatband style. One way to easily rock a sweatband with short hair is by carefully pulling the hair away from your face then placing the sweatband around your head and behind your ears so that it runs around the entirety of your hairline. Not only is this a simplistic way to style your hair for the day, but it also shows you one of many ways one can wear a sweatband all day without worrying that you did not do much to your hair.
Try securing your hair in a fashion that suits you and then add a little pop of color with a sweatband either around your hairline or further down the forehead. For really short hair, one might consider placing a sweatband around the hairline and over the hair so that all of your hair stays secure. This is especially ideal for exercise.
Perhaps you have lost your hair or you simply choose to buzz it off - we are not here to judge! While you might think you are at a disadvantage, especially if you previously lost your hair, a sweatband is an excellent option for you!
And when it comes to styling it and wearing it in the ideal style, when you have little to no hair, you are without restraint. By this we mean you can wear it any way you wish without the restrictions of hair. For a classic look, simply wear it around the forehead for a cool, effortless appearance. When dealing with longer hair, the ways in which you can appropriately wear a sweatband increase greatly.
The possibilities are practically endless. Whether you decide to throw your hair up and wrap your sweatband horizontally around your forehead or underneath your hair on your hairline while it sits naturally, the decision is yours. For an easy natural do, pull your hair up into a ponytail and place your sweatband around your head. Now, let your hair back down so that it falls perfectly over the sweatband for a sweat-free experience. If hair control is what you need, simply place a sweatband around your forehead and over your hair for complete security.
